From: DC
Dear Ministry of Social Development,
Please treat this as a request for official information under the Official Information Act 1982.
This request is made in the public interest to support transparency around how fiscal responsibility, workforce growth, and leadership accountability are reflected in MSD’s operating model. As someone with a strong interest in the performance and efficiency of large public organisations, I believe this information is essential to understanding scale, structure, and resource prioritisation over time.
The information requested below should be readily available through internal financial and operational reporting.
1. Budget vs Actual Expenditure by Executive Portfolio – FY2021 to FY2024
For each financial year from FY2021 to FY2024, please provide the following for each Deputy Chief Executive (DCE) or equivalent ELT member’s portfolio (i.e., all cost centres and operational areas reporting to them):
- The approved annual budget and actual expenditure.
- If any dollar values are considered sensitive, percentage variance (over/under budget) is acceptable as an alternative.
- Please include the name of the relevant DCE or ELT member responsible for each portfolio in each year.
2. FTE by Executive Portfolio – FY2021 to Present
For each DCE or Executive Leadership Team portfolio, please provide:
- The budgeted FTE vs actual FTE for each financial year from FY2021 through to the current financial year to date.
- The year-on-year change in actual FTE (as a number or percentage).
- If more granular reporting (e.g. quarterly or mid-year tracking) is available internally, that level of detail is welcomed.
In addition, for front-line or service delivery roles, please provide:
- Any instances since FY2021 to the date of this request where increases in FTE were sought and approved.
- Copies of or excerpts from approval documentation, such as ELT or Ministerial/Board memos, that supported or approved additional headcount for front-line services (e.g. service centres, contact centres, work brokers, case management, etc.).
These are foundational indicators of fiscal discipline, organisational scale, and accountability for delivery. If any aspect of the request is likely to require substantial collation under section 18(f) of the Act, I’d appreciate early notice so I can consider refining the scope.
